安装和卸载Mysql(压缩版)

一、安装Mysql

1.解压后在文件夹里创建一个名为"data"的文件夹,再新建一个名为"my.ini"的文件

2.打开"my.ini"文件,编辑,复制以下内容到文件里面(注意,安装目录不能有中文,并且把"\"改为"\\")

html 复制代码
[mysqld]
# skip_grant_tables
# 设置3306端口
port=3306
# 设置mysql的安装目录
basedir=E:\\yunjisuan\\mysql\\mysql-5.7.28-winx64
# 设置mysql数据库的数据的存放目录
datadir=E:\\yunjisuan\\mysql\\mysql-5.7.28-winx64\\data
# 允许最大连接数
max_connections=200
# 允许连接失败的次数。这是为了防止有人从该主机试图攻击数据库系统
max_connect_errors=10
# 服务端使用的字符集默认为UTF8
character-set-server=utf8mb4
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
# 默认使用"mysql_native_password"插件认证
default_authentication_plugin=mysql_native_password
#开启二进制日志
log-bin=mysql-bin
#指定写入二进制的事件格式
binlog-format=MIXED
#给mysql服务器分配id
server-id=1001

[client]
#password = your_password
# 设置mysql客户端连接服务端时默认使用的端口
port=3306
default-character-set=utf8mb4

[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8mb4

3.配置环境变量

进去后编辑,把安装路径写上去

4.初始化Mysql

打开cmd

输入"mysqld --initialize --console"并记住临时密码

创建Mysql服务名称

mysqld --install mysql8

然后重新打开cmd,输入"net start mysql8"启动mysql

5.使用临时密码登录

mysql -uroot -p

6.修改密码

html 复制代码
ALTER USER root@localhost IDENTIFIED mysql_native_password BY '新密码';
ALTER USER root@localhost IDENTIFIED BY 'root';

二、卸载

先在cmd停止服务

html 复制代码
net stop mysql8

然后删除解压"mysql"文件夹即可

三、图书管理系统

1.图书管理系统数据库

2.用户表

3.图书表

4.借阅登记表

相关推荐
Hello.Reader1 分钟前
Flink SQL Window Join 把时间维度“写进” JOIN 条件里
数据库·sql·flink
爬山算法5 分钟前
Redis(172)如何使用Redis实现分布式队?
数据库·redis·分布式
古城小栈10 分钟前
QPS统计好,睡觉不会被打扰
运维·数据库·压力测试
shayudiandian11 分钟前
一键部署MySQL黑科技
数据库·科技·mysql
Misnice16 分钟前
使用 SQLAlchemy 连接数据库
数据库·python·mysql·fastapi
Shingmc322 分钟前
MySQL数据类型
数据库·mysql
秦jh_24 分钟前
【Qt】信号与槽
服务器·开发语言·数据库·qt
微信-since8119225 分钟前
[ruby on rails] pg 数据库性能问题排查与解决完整记录
数据库·ruby on rails·oracle
hanyi_qwe28 分钟前
关系型数据库 vs 非关系型数据库
数据库·nosql
西***634731 分钟前
指挥中心 “协同密码”:KVM 坐席协作系统如何破解数据壁垒与安全难题?
数据库